Description

Bently Nevada 330130-045-12-05 specifies a 4.5-meter (14.8 feet) FluidLoc extension cable with pre-installed connector protectors and CSA, ATEX, and IECEx hazardous area approvals for 3300 XL 8 mm proximity transducer systems. This cable configuration is selected for applications requiring reliable sealing against fluid migration and enhanced environmental shielding at the connector junction. By employing the specialized FluidLoc cable, this assembly blocks oil, moisture, and other process liquids from traveling through the cable interior and exiting the machine casing, maintaining housing integrity in high-exposure industrial environments.

Unlike standard unarmored configurations, the Option 12 variant includes pre-installed fluorosilicone connector protectors on the female connector end. These protectors shield the gold-plated ClickLoc connector from fluids, grime, and physical wear, eliminating the need for manual taping or field-fitted boots. The 4.5-meter length is typically matched with a 0.5-meter probe to achieve a complete 5.0-meter transducer system, or configured in other compatible matching system lengths to align with the calibrated input requirements of the 3300 XL Proximitor Sensor.

Features

  • FluidLoc Cable Construction: Features a patented inner seal design that prevents oil and other process liquids from leaking along the cable interior.
  • Integrated Connector Protectors: Includes pre-installed fluorosilicone connector protectors on the female end to seal the ClickLoc connection against oil, moisture, and debris.
  • 4.5-Meter Length: Precision-calibrated 4.5 m (14.8 feet) coaxial cable length ensuring matched electrical impedance for accurate vibration and position measurements.
  • ClickLoc Connectors: Corrosion-resistant, gold-plated brass connectors that lock securely with a tactile click, requiring no special installation tools.
  • Hazardous Area Approval (Option 05): Certified for intrinsically safe and non-incendive installations under CSA, ATEX, and IECEx agency standards.
  • High Durability: FEP insulation provides resistance to chemical exposure and high temperatures within the standard operating range.

Applications

This extension cable is used in machinery protection and condition monitoring systems on rotating equipment. It is particularly suited for:

  • Steam and gas turbine bearing housing vibration monitoring.
  • Centrifugal compressor shaft vibration and axial position measurement.
  • Gearbox shaft relative displacement tracking in wet or oil-rich environments.
  • Hazardous area machinery installations requiring ATEX, IECEx, or CSA certification.
  • Generators and pumps where high-pressure oil containment is critical.

Installation Guidelines

  • Torque Specification: Connectors should be tightened finger-tight. The ClickLoc mechanism will "click" to signify a secure, locked connection. Do not use pliers or other tools on XL gold connectors.
  • Cable Bend Radius: Maintain a minimum bend radius of 25.4 mm (1.0 inch) during routing to prevent signal degradation or internal conductor failure.
  • Routing: Route the extension cable through protective conduit or cable trays to prevent physical damage from machinery movement. Avoid routing near high-voltage lines to minimize electromagnetic interference.
  • Connector Protection: Ensure the fluorosilicone connector protector is fully seated over the connection joint to prevent ingress of oils, water, or particulate contaminants.

What is the purpose of the FluidLoc option on this extension cable?

The FluidLoc option (Option 12) prevents oil, water, and other process liquids from leaking out of the machine casing by blocking passage through the internal spaces of the cable.

Which proximity probes and sensors is the 330130-045-12-05 compatible with?

This extension cable is compatible with Bently Nevada 3300 XL 8 mm proximity probes and standard 3300 XL Proximitor sensors. The combined length of the probe and this extension cable must match the calibrated length of the Proximitor sensor (typically 5.0 or 9.0 meters).

What is the length of this specific extension cable variant?

The 330130-045-12-05 variant has a calibrated cable length of 4.5 meters (14.8 feet).

Does the 330130-045-12-05 come with pre-installed connector protectors?

Yes, Option 12 includes a pre-installed fluorosilicone connector protector on the female connector end to ensure robust environmental sealing against moisture and oil ingress.

What hazardous area certifications are covered by Option 05?

Option 05 designates approvals for CSA, ATEX, and IECEx, allowing safe operation of the proximity transducer system in intrinsically safe and non-incendive environments.
